You would love a CD by VE3ERP called "Hamcalc."  Send the guy $10 (he
only

asks for $7 but the funds go to the Canada Blind Society) and you will
get a CD

that does most of the mundane math problems hams face.

The only catch is that it is DOS.

I've used this program (in several iterations) for years.  Great stuff!
